What is the purpose of a Guardianship Certificate in Pakistan?

A Guardianship Certificate serves a crucial role in legal systems worldwide, including Pakistan.The purpose of a guardianship certificate is to establish and formalize the legal authority and responsibility of an individual to act as the guardian of another person, typically a minor or someone who is unable to make decisions independently due to incapacity. This legal document is designed to protect the rights and well-being of individuals who, for various reasons, are not fully capable of managing their own affairs. 1. Protecting Vulnerable Individuals: The primary purpose of a guardianship certificate is to safeguard the interests and well-being of vulnerable individuals. This includes minors, individuals with disabilities, or those facing other circumstances that render them unable to make informed decisions about their lives.
